Post by: AndrewT on October 25, 2012, 11:59:33 PM
So, the axe has been wielded and McCririck's a goner. Predictably, he's bowed out with good grace and decor..oh wait.

http://www.guardian.co.uk/sport/2012/oct/25/john-mccririck-channel4-ageism-axed

Also gone - Alastair Down, Mike Cattermole, and Thommo (Francome and Lesley Graham we already knew about)

Staying - Emma Spencer, Simon Holt, Richard Hoiles, Jim McGrath, Tanya

Coming in - Nick Luck, Graham Cunningham, Rishi Persad, Mick Fitzgerald and the cute-as-a-button Gina Bryce.

A pretty good cutting of deadweight but it would have been impossible for them to really screw this up, as they could pick and choose the best from the BBC and the two racing channels. Rishi I could do without - too much of a transparent blando like Jake Humphries (who has now turned up presenting the One Show - his natural home)
